Factors Affecting CostsSeveral factors influence the cost of window handle replacement, consisting of:
Type of Window Handle: The style and product of the window handle can significantly impact the cost, with specialized and high-end models costing more.
Window Type: Different types of windows (casement, awning, sliding, and so on) may need specific handles, impacting the availability of compatible choices and, subsequently, costs.
Labor Costs: If the replacement is carried out by a professional, labor costs will vary based upon area and job complexity.
DIY vs. Hiring a Professional: Homeowners who decide to replace the handle themselves might conserve money however should consider their skill level and the potential for errors.
Extra Repairs: If there are underlying issues with the window mechanism or frame, extra repair work may increase the overall cost.
Cost Breakdown
Below is a comprehensive cost breakdown for window handle replacement, incorporating parts and labor.
Cost ComponentEstimated Cost (GBP)Window HandleFundamental Plastic Handle₤ 10 - ₤ 30Requirement Metal Handle₤ 20 - ₤ 50High-End Designer Handle₤ 50 - ₤ 150Labor (if employed)Basic Installation₤ 50 - ₤ 100Complex Installation₤ 100 - ₤ 200Total CostDIY Installation₤ 10 - ₤ 150Professional Installation₤ 100 - ₤ 350Keep in mind: Prices can vary based on geographic area, shop pricing, and particular window requirements.
Tools Required
When thinking about a DIY window handle replacement, it's necessary to have the right tools to make sure a smooth procedure. Below are the common tools required:
- Screwdriver: Typically, a Phillips or flat-head screwdriver will be essential.
- Pliers: Useful for getting rid of stubborn screws or handles.
- Replacement Handle: Ensure you have the right replacement for your particular window type.
- Shatterproof glass: To safeguard your eyes while working.
- Gloves: Optional for hand protection.
Step-by-Step Replacement Process
For those inclined to change the window handle themselves, following these steps can help ensure a successful result:
Gather the Necessary Tools: Ensure you have actually all needed tools and the proper replacement handle.
Remove the Old Handle:
- Use a screwdriver to eliminate any screws holding the handle in place.
- Carefully pull the handle far from the window frame.
Check for Damage: Check for any extra damage to the window system. Change any broken elements as required.
Install the New Handle:
- Position the new handle into location.
- Secure it with screws, ensuring it is tight however not extremely so, to avoid harming the handle or frame.
Check the Handle: Open and close the window to ensure the handle works efficiently and securely.
FAQ Section
Q1: How typically should I change my window handles?
Answer: There's no specific timeline, however it's recommended to examine window handles every couple of years for indications of wear. If a handle ends up being stiff or harmed, it's time for replacement.
Q2: Can I utilize any window handle for my windows?
Answer: Not all window handles in shape every window type. Guarantee you purchase a handle that works with your particular window model to prevent problems with installation or performance.
Q3: Is it worth it to work with a professional for window handle replacement?
Response: If you are unskilled with DIY jobs or your windows have intricate mechanisms, working with a professional may be the best option to guarantee appropriate setup and functionality.
Q4: Can I replace simply one window handle, or should I do all of them at the same time?
Response: It depends upon the condition of the other handles. If the handles are revealing comparable signs of wear or if they become part of a consistent design aesthetic, replacing them at the same time could be helpful.
Q5: How can I avoid damage to my window handles during usage?
Answer: Regular upkeep is key. Look for any blockages when running windows, prevent extreme force when opening or closing, and keep handles tidy to prevent dirt buildup.
